The Opportunity
Our Grid Automation business unit offers a comprehensive portfolio of solutions, ranging from substation automation and communication networks to grid automation services and enterprise software solutions. These innovative solutions address all key segments connected to the energy system, including generation, transmission, distribution, industries, transportation, and infrastructure sectors.
